The Federal Indigenous Affairs Minister says from July 30 next year he will cease doing business with any organisations that are not Aboriginal.

The announcement came as the Minister – Nigel Scullion – announced a further $4 million in funding for the Registrar for Indigenous Corporations.

Scullion says the move, which has upset some church organisations that provide services to Aboriginal communities, is the best way to go.

 

 

Registrar for Indigenous Corporations Anthony Beven says the top 500 Indigenous corporations have increased their income by 74 per cent since 2007.

 

 

“I applaud the Government’s decision to invest additional resources into supporting Indigenous corporations. This will deliver stronger governance and therefore better outcomes for Indigenous people and communities,” Mr Beven said.

Minister Scullion also release a review into ORIC which found overall it has been doing “a good job, in a challenging regulatory environment and in the context of substantial funding decreases in funding and staffing.”
